Challenges I ran into

During the development of BitWars, several challenges were encountered. Here are some of the major challenges:

Smart contract integration: Integrating the smart contract with the front end was a significant challenge. It involved understanding how to call functions from the smart contract on the front end, as well as how to update the user interface in real-time based on data from the blockchain.

Push Protocol implementation: Implementing the Push Protocol for real-time communication between players was another challenge. It involved understanding how to use the Push Protocol libraries and APIs, as well as integrating it with the game's backend to handle messaging between players.
